About Me

CURRENT MISSION

The most current objective is to travel clockwise around the continental United States (Minneapolis is midnight). This will involve city stays in New York, New Orleans, Austin, L.A., San Francisco, and Portland. That's where couches are, we hear.

ABOUT ME

This profile exists for Jodi and Joe as a couple. The website doesn't give us a way to write that in all spaces, so let's write it here. We'll speak as a couple where appropriate and diverge into individuals when appropriate. We have been together for two years, and have lived together for one. We currently live in South Minneapolis. We have travelled throughout Minnesota and Wisconsin, as well as to the Upper Peninsula of Michigan. We camp, and have never couch-surfed, but have hosted several couchsurfers through friends.

Jodi and Joe have graduated with bachelors degrees, Joe in Literature and Jodi in Horticulture. We are currently on the borderlands between committing our lives' work to a suitable career (or beginning that process), or shucking that process and generating our own livelihoods, homesteading, divorced as much as possible from the global economy. This trip represents an exploration of forms of the latter, which we might learn from and piece into our own. Dividing time between the urban and the rural (small-scale farms and the communities surrounding them), we will be entering the lives of others with open eyes and minds, eager to share and learn.

One Amazing Thing I’ve Done

Jodi and I found ourselves on a frozen lake in the middle of a snowstorm, while at her family's cabin in Northern Wisconsin. It was snowing so heavily, big flakes in our face. Out of nowhere came two awesome dogs, who we ran around in circles with, tracing wide circles in the snow on the lake. One of the dogs would wind up from thirty feet away, and come racing into the other. We found ourselves sticking up for the attacked dog, diverting the speeding one away from it at the last moment. It was funny and sad. I can barely remember an experience of a blizzard as well as this one, and I'm happy Jodi and the pups were there for it.
